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Sign up
Appearance settings

Commit 66c3b0b

Browse files
author
mengyaoyao
committed
update
1 parent 9f669f9 commit 66c3b0b

File tree

3 files changed

+9
-6
lines changed

3 files changed

+9
-6
lines changed

‎CocoaAsyncSocket_TCP/ChatHandler/ChatHandler.m

Lines changed: 7 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-339,7 +339,7 @@ - (void)sendTextMessage:(ChatModel *)textModel
339339
{
340340
dispatch_after(dispatch_time(DISPATCH_TIME_NOW, (int64_t)(1 * NSEC_PER_SEC)), dispatch_get_main_queue(), ^{
341341

342-
//模拟回执
342+
//模拟服务器回执
343343
ChatModel *receipet = [[ChatModel alloc]init];
344344
receipet.messageType = Message_NormalReceipt;
345345
receipet.sendTime = textModel.sendTime;
@@ -375,9 +375,10 @@ - (void)sendTextMessage:(ChatModel *)textModel
375375
//发送语音消息
376376
- (void)sendAudioMessage:(ChatModel *)audioModel
377377
{
378+
//此处调用上传 , 上传成功后调用socket发送消息
378379
dispatch_after(dispatch_time(DISPATCH_TIME_NOW, (int64_t)(1 * NSEC_PER_SEC)), dispatch_get_main_queue(), ^{
379380

380-
//模拟回执
381+
//模拟服务器回执
381382
ChatModel *receipet = [[ChatModel alloc]init];
382383
receipet.messageType = Message_NormalReceipt;
383384
receipet.sendTime = audioModel.sendTime;
@@ -413,14 +414,16 @@ - (void)sendAudioMessage:(ChatModel *)audioModel
413414
//发送图片消息
414415
- (void)sendPicMessage:(NSArray<ChatModel *>*)picModels
415416
{
416-
417+
418+
//此处调用上传 , 上传成功后调用socket发送消息
417419
[picModels enumerateObjectsUsingBlock:^(ChatModel * _Nonnull obj, NSUInteger idx, BOOL * _Nonnull stop) {
418420
dispatch_after(dispatch_time(DISPATCH_TIME_NOW, (int64_t)(1 * NSEC_PER_SEC)), dispatch_get_main_queue(), ^{
419421

420-
//模拟回执
422+
//模拟服务器回执
421423
ChatModel *receipet = [[ChatModel alloc]init];
422424
receipet.messageType = Message_NormalReceipt;
423425
receipet.sendTime = obj.sendTime;
426+
NSLog(@"---回执--%@",receipet.sendTime);
424427
ChatMessageType type = ChatMessageType_NormalReceipt;
425428
for (id<ChatHandlerDelegate>delegate in self.delegates) {
426429
if ([delegate respondsToSelector:@selector(didReceiveMessage:type:)]) {

‎CocoaAsyncSocket_TCP/ChatHandler/ChatUtil.m

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-129,7 +129,7 @@ + (ChatModel *)creatMessageModel:(ChatModel *)config
129129
chatModel.groupName = config.groupName;
130130
chatModel.noDisturb = config.noDisturb;
131131

132-
return chatModel;
132+
return chatModel;
133133
}
134134

135135
//初始化文本消息模型

‎CocoaAsyncSocket_TCP/View/ChatCells/ChatImageCell.m

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-171,7 +171,7 @@ - (void)setImageModel:(ChatModel *)imageModel
171171
//处理失败按钮 , 处理进度按钮 ,昵称隐藏处理
172172
BOOL isSend = [imageModel.isSend integerValue];
173173
self.failureButton.hidden = !imageModel.byMyself.integerValue || isSend || imageModel.isSending.integerValue;
174-
self.progressLabel.hidden = !imageModel.byMyself.integerValue || imageModel.isSending.integerValue;
174+
self.progressLabel.hidden = !imageModel.byMyself.integerValue || !imageModel.isSending.integerValue;
175175
self.nickNameLabel.hidden = imageModel.byMyself.integerValue || hashEqual(imageModel.chatType, @"userChat");
176176

177177
//赋值

0 commit comments

Comments
(0)

AltStyle によって変換されたページ (->オリジナル) /